Q: Is 436,645,627 a Prime Number?
A: No, 436,645,627 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 436645627 can be evenly divided by 1 11 317 3,487 125,221 1,377,431 39,695,057 and 436,645,627, with no remainder.
Since 436,645,627 cannot be divided by just 1 and 436,645,627, it is not a prime number.
